package data
import (
"fmt"
"github.com/ethereum/go-ethereum/common"
"github.com/ethereum/go-ethereum/common/hexutil"
"github.com/graph-gophers/graphql-go"
)
const StatusParseErr = StatusErr("Invalid status")
type StatusErr string
func (s StatusErr) Error() string {
return string(s)
}
// Define the Go struct for the Status enum type.
type Status string
func ParseStatus(s string) (Status, error) {
switch s {
case string(StatusFailed):
return StatusFailed, nil
case string(StatusPending):
return StatusPending, nil
case string(StatusSuccess):
return StatusSuccess, nil
default:
return Status(""), StatusParseErr
}
}
func MustParseStatus(s string) Status {
st, err := ParseStatus(s)
if err != nil {
panic(err)
}
return st
}
const (
StatusFailed Status = "FAILED"
StatusPending Status = "PENDING"
StatusSuccess Status = "SUCCESS"
)
type Chainer interface {
Chain(id string) (Chain, bool)
}
// Define the Go struct for the XMsg type.
type XMsg struct {
Chainer
ID graphql.ID
Block XBlock
To common.Address
Data hexutil.Bytes
DestChainID hexutil.Big
GasLimit hexutil.Big
DisplayID string
Offset hexutil.Big
Receipt *XReceipt
Sender common.Address
SourceChainID hexutil.Big
Status Status
TxHash common.Hash
}
func (m XMsg) ToURL() string {
c, ok := m.Chain(m.DestChainID.String())
if !ok {
return ""
}
return c.AddrUrl(m.To)
}
func (m XMsg) SenderURL() string {
c, ok := m.Chain(m.SourceChainID.String())
if !ok {
return ""
}
return c.AddrUrl(m.Sender)
}
func (m XMsg) TxURL() string {
c, ok := m.Chain(m.SourceChainID.String())
if !ok {
return ""
}
return c.TxUrl(m.TxHash)
}
func (m XMsg) SourceChain() (Chain, error) {
c, ok := m.Chain(m.SourceChainID.String())
if !ok {
return Chain{}, fmt.Errorf("chain not found: %s", m.SourceChainID.String())
}
return c, nil
}
func (m XMsg) DestChain() (Chain, error) {
c, ok := m.Chain(m.DestChainID.String())
if !ok {
return Chain{}, fmt.Errorf("chain not found: %s", m.DestChainID.String())
}
return c, nil
}
// Define the Go struct for the XBlock type.
type XBlock struct {
Chainer
ID graphql.ID
ChainID hexutil.Big
Height hexutil.Big
Hash common.Hash
Messages []XMsg
Timestamp graphql.Time
}
func (b XBlock) Chain() (Chain, error) {
c, ok := b.Chainer.Chain(b.ChainID.String())
if !ok {
return Chain{}, fmt.Errorf("chain not found: %s", b.ChainID.String())
}
return c, nil
}
func (b XBlock) URL() (string, error) {
c, ok := b.Chainer.Chain(b.ChainID.String())
if !ok {
return "", fmt.Errorf("chain not found: %s", b.ChainID.String())
}
return c.BlockURL(b.Height.ToInt().Uint64()), nil
}
// Define the Go struct for the XReceipt type.
type XReceipt struct {
Chainer
ID graphql.ID
GasUsed hexutil.Big
Success bool
Relayer common.Address
SourceChainID hexutil.Big
DestChainID hexutil.Big
Offset hexutil.Big
TxHash common.Hash
Timestamp graphql.Time
RevertReason *string
}
func (r *XReceipt) TxURL() string {
c, ok := r.Chain(r.SourceChainID.String())
if !ok {
return ""
}
return c.TxUrl(r.TxHash)
}
func (r *XReceipt) SourceChain() (Chain, error) {
c, ok := r.Chain(r.SourceChainID.String())
if !ok {
return Chain{}, fmt.Errorf("chain not found: %s", r.SourceChainID.String())
}
return c, nil
}
func (r *XReceipt) DestChain() (Chain, error) {
c, ok := r.Chain(r.DestChainID.String())
if !ok {
return Chain{}, fmt.Errorf("chain not found: %s", r.DestChainID.String())
}
return c, nil
}
// Define the Go struct for the Chain type.
type Chain struct {
AddrURLFmt string
BlockURLFmt string
TxURLFmt string
ID graphql.ID
ChainID hexutil.Big
DisplayID Long
Name string
LogoURL string
}
func (c *Chain) AddrUrl(addr common.Address) string {
if c.AddrURLFmt == "" {
return ""
}
return fmt.Sprintf(c.AddrURLFmt, addr)
}
func (c *Chain) BlockURL(height uint64) string {
if c.BlockURLFmt == "" {
return ""
}
return fmt.Sprintf(c.BlockURLFmt, height)
}
func (c *Chain) TxUrl(tx common.Hash) string {
if c.TxURLFmt == "" {
return ""
}
return fmt.Sprintf(c.TxURLFmt, tx.String())
}
// Define the Go struct for the XMsgConnection type.
type XMsgConnection struct {
TotalCount Long
Edges []XMsgEdge
PageInfo PageInfo
}
// Define the Go struct for the XMsgEdge type.
type XMsgEdge struct {
Cursor graphql.ID
Node XMsg
}
// Define the Go struct for the PageInfo type.
type PageInfo struct {
HasNextPage bool
HasPrevPage bool
TotalPages Long
CurrentPage Long
}
// Define the Go struct for the StatsResult type.
type StatsResult struct {
TotalMsgs Long
TopStreams []StreamStats
}
// Define the Go struct for the StreamStats type.
type StreamStats struct {
SourceChain Chain
DestChain Chain
MsgCount Long
}
